Output 609aa31d53c1f1988704cf6dd78fb958e33a9f8bc4af042d42160c3650d57777:7

value
11228595
script pubkey
OP_0 OP_PUSHBYTES_20 ecfe25ab10ac8592206b9b560d2755dea74be92e
address
ltc1qanlzt2cs4jzeygrtndtq6f64m6n5h6fwppeh4w
transaction
609aa31d53c1f1988704cf6dd78fb958e33a9f8bc4af042d42160c3650d57777
spent
true